public class StandardServiceRegistryImpl extends AbstractServiceRegistryImpl implements StandardServiceRegistry
ALLOW_CRAWLING| Constructor and Description |
|---|
StandardServiceRegistryImpl(boolean autoCloseRegistry,
BootstrapServiceRegistry bootstrapServiceRegistry,
java.util.List<StandardServiceInitiator> serviceInitiators,
java.util.List<ProvidedService> providedServices,
java.util.Map<?,?> configurationValues)
Constructs a StandardServiceRegistryImpl.
|
StandardServiceRegistryImpl(BootstrapServiceRegistry bootstrapServiceRegistry,
java.util.List<StandardServiceInitiator> serviceInitiators,
java.util.List<ProvidedService> providedServices,
java.util.Map<?,?> configurationValues)
Constructs a StandardServiceRegistryImpl.
|
| Modifier and Type | Method and Description |
|---|---|
<R extends Service> |
configureService(ServiceBinding<R> serviceBinding) |
<R extends Service> |
initiateService(ServiceInitiator<R> serviceInitiator) |
createService, createServiceBinding, createServiceBinding, deRegisterChild, destroy, getParentServiceRegistry, getService, injectDependencies, isActive, locateServiceBinding, locateServiceBinding, registerChild, registerService, startService, stopServicecl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itgetParentServiceRegistry, getServicepublic StandardServiceRegistryImpl(BootstrapServiceRegistry bootstrapServiceRegistry, java.util.List<StandardServiceInitiator> serviceInitiators, java.util.List<ProvidedService> providedServices, java.util.Map<?,?> configurationValues)
StandardServiceRegistryBuilder insteadbootstrapServiceRegistry - The bootstrap service registry.serviceInitiators - Any StandardServiceInitiators provided by the user to the builderprovidedServices - Any standard services provided directly to the builderconfigurationValues - Configuration valuesStandardServiceRegistryBuilderpublic StandardServiceRegistryImpl(boolean autoCloseRegistry,
BootstrapServiceRegistry bootstrapServiceRegistry,
java.util.List<StandardServiceInitiator> serviceInitiators,
java.util.List<ProvidedService> providedServices,
java.util.Map<?,?> configurationValues)
StandardServiceRegistryBuilder insteadautoCloseRegistry - See discussion on
StandardServiceRegistryBuilder.disableAutoClose()bootstrapServiceRegistry - The bootstrap service registry.serviceInitiators - Any StandardServiceInitiators provided by the user to the builderprovidedServices - Any standard services provided directly to the builderconfigurationValues - Configuration valuesStandardServiceRegistryBuilderpublic <R extends Service> R initiateService(ServiceInitiator<R> serviceInitiator)
initiateService in interface ServiceBinding.ServiceLifecycleOwnerpublic <R extends Service> void configureService(ServiceBinding<R> serviceBinding)
configureService in interface ServiceBinding.ServiceLifecycleOwnerCopyright © 2001-2018 Red Hat, Inc. All Rights Reserved.